What You Will Do:Guidehouse is seeking a Data Scientist to join our AI & Data Defense and Security Segment in support of Department of Homeland Security (DHS) programs. This role will directly support a multi-disciplinary fusion cell, collaborating with All-Source Analysts, GEOINT and SIGINT Analysts, a Forensic Accountant, and a Cryptocurrency Subject Matter Expert to integrate and analyze diverse data sets. The Data Scientist will be responsible for fusing structured and unstructured data sources (e.g., FinCEN, open-source intelligence, geospatial data platforms such as ArcGIS) and developing automated analytical workflows and models to enhance investigative efficiency and insight generation.
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
- Supporting a fusion cell by integrating and analyzing data sets (FinCEN, Open Source, ArcGIS, etc.)
- Collecting, cleaning, transforming, and analyzing large datasets using tools such as Python, R, and SQL
- Performing data fusion and entity resolution across disparate systems and datasets
- Designing and developing data visualization and dashboard solutions (e.g., Power BI) to communicate analytical insights
- Developing and maintaining data models, algorithms, and automated processes to support investigative and analytical workflows
- Identifying patterns, trends, and anomalies to support investigative efforts and operational decision-making
- Ensuring data governance, quality assurance, and validation standards are met
- Analyzing existing processes and identifying opportunities for automation and optimization
- Collaborating with cross-functional team members to translate analytical findings into insights
- Summarizing and presenting results and recommendations through written reports and briefings
